一種多服務器代碼發(fā)布方法及系統(tǒng)

基本信息

申請?zhí)?/td> CN202110282501.3 申請日 -
公開(公告)號 CN113094066A 公開(公告)日 2021-07-09
申請公布號 CN113094066A 申請公布日 2021-07-09
分類號 G06F8/65(2018.01)I;G06F8/71(2018.01)I;G06F9/50(2006.01)I;G06F11/36(2006.01)I 分類 計算;推算;計數(shù);
發(fā)明人 孟艷冬;郭澤謙;楊棟東 申請(專利權)人 北京優(yōu)奧創(chuàng)思科技發(fā)展有限公司
代理機構 北京知呱呱知識產權代理有限公司 代理人 杜立軍
地址 100020北京市朝陽區(qū)高井文化園路8號東億國際傳媒產業(yè)園區(qū)三期C座4層402
法律狀態(tài) -

摘要

摘要 一種多服務器代碼發(fā)布方法及系統(tǒng),通過Jenkins任務拉取Git倉庫代碼,構建配置發(fā)布參數(shù),將代碼發(fā)布項目推送到預發(fā)布服務器測試;測試通過后,創(chuàng)建代碼發(fā)布項目發(fā)布申請,對代碼發(fā)布申請進行審核;審核通過后,將待進行同步的代碼發(fā)布項目寫入標識,并創(chuàng)建Git倉庫當前代碼的新標簽,將測試并審核完畢的代碼同步到正式平臺的每臺負載;負載定時查詢是否有代碼發(fā)布項目需要同步,當檢測到有要同步的代碼發(fā)布項目后,根據項目下文件的時間判定是否進行同步處理;當所有負載同步完成后,回寫任務發(fā)布記錄,根據負載是否同步成功進行發(fā)布狀態(tài)標識。本技術方案實現(xiàn)多模塊代碼獨立、可視化發(fā)布,有效控制發(fā)布和實現(xiàn)代碼發(fā)布的機動性。